The search phrase represents a highly specific, high-risk query pattern commonly seen in search engines. To understand what this string means, it helps to break down its core parts: iBilling refers to a popular CRM and invoice management software framework, 5.0.0 or 500 indicates a version number, and rar signifies a compressed file archive. The suffix +hot is standard search modifier jargon used to seek out functional, cracked, or active digital downloads.

Every legitimate software purchase pays for the countless hours of development, testing, documentation, and support that go into creating a product like iBilling. By using a nulled version, you are actively stealing the labor of the developers and undermining the entire marketplace that provides tools for small businesses. Without sales, developers go out of business, and the software ceases to exist.
